Quartic.AI Appoints David Hsieh as New Chief Executive Officer

Retrieved on: 
Wednesday, May 11, 2022

SAN JOSE, Calif., May 11, 2022 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Quartic.ai, provider of an enterprise-scale AI platform that makes autonomous manufacturing a reality, announced it has named Silicon Valley veteran, David Hsieh, to the role of Chief Executive Officer. Prior to joining Quartic, Hsieh held senior executive positions at Cisco, Sybase, Webex, Ubiquiti, and Facetime Communications, and most recently served as CEO of Kaptivo (acquired by Lifesize in 2020). Hsieh is a passionate leader, motivator, and team-builder who blends strategy and creativity to reshape markets and build companies.

Ubiquiti Inc. Reports Third Quarter Fiscal 2022 Financial Results

Retrieved on: 
Friday, May 6, 2022

Revenues for the first nine months of fiscal 2022 were $1,248.5 million, representing a decrease of 12.1% compared to the first nine months of fiscal 2021.

  • Revenues for the first nine months of fiscal 2022 were $1,248.5 million, representing a decrease of 12.1% compared to the first nine months of fiscal 2021.
  • During the third quarter fiscal 2022, gross profit was $116.0 million.
  • During the third quarter fiscal 2022, GAAP net income was $50.4 million and non-GAAP net income was $51.0 million.
  • Third quarter fiscal 2022 GAAP earnings per diluted share was $0.82 and non-GAAP earnings per diluted share was $0.83.

Worldwide Enterprise WLAN Market Shows Strong Growth in Q4 and the Full Year 2021, According to IDC

Retrieved on: 
Wednesday, March 9, 2022

Growth in the enterprise WLAN market continues to be driven by the latest Wi-Fi standard, known as Wi-Fi 6 or 802.11ax.

  • The enterprise WLAN market in the United States rose 15.4% in 4Q21 and increased 14.6% for the full year.
  • In the Middle East & Africa, the enterprise WLAN market rose 4.8% in the quarter and grew 6.6% for the full year.

Ubiquiti Inc. Reports Second Quarter Fiscal 2022 Financial Results

Retrieved on: 
Friday, February 4, 2022

During the second quarter fiscal 2022, gross profit was $174.7 million.

  • The Companys sales, general and administrative (SG&A) expenses for the second quarter fiscal 2022 were $16.4 million.
  • During the second quarter fiscal 2022, GAAP net income was $103.6 million and non-GAAP net income was $103.4 million.
  • Second quarter fiscal 2022 GAAP earnings per diluted share was $1.66 and non-GAAP earnings per diluted share was $1.66.
